Summary |
Technology transfer is shown here to be much more complicated than the mere handover of new technology hardware to developing countries. It is about innovation and learning and its effective management depends on generating new knowledge and being able to react quickly and effectively to change. The book covers the practical issues of technology transfer, including product, process, cost reduction, integration of local materials, import substitution, employee involvement, and the improvement of safety and working conditions.
